Painting Description
"An Actress with a Mask" is an oil painting by Eva Gonzalès, a French Impressionist artist known for her portraiture and genre scenes. Created in 1877, the painting is a notable example of Gonzalès's work, which often explored themes of femininity and the private lives of women. The artwork depicts a female actress holding a mask, a common symbol for the performative aspects of social roles and identity. The subject's contemplative gaze and the contrast between her visage and the mask she holds invite viewers to reflect on the duality of public and private personas.
Eva Gonzalès (1849–1883) was a student of the celebrated artist Édouard Manet and is recognized for her contributions to the Impressionist movement, despite not exhibiting with the Impressionist group. Her work is characterized by a delicate touch, attention to detail, and a soft color palette. "An Actress with a Mask" exemplifies her skill in capturing the texture of fabrics and the subtleties of light and shadow.
The painting is part of Gonzalès's limited oeuvre, as her career was cut short by her untimely death at the age of 34, just days after giving birth to her son. Despite her brief career, Gonzalès's work has garnered attention for its unique perspective within the predominantly male Impressionist circle. "An Actress with a Mask" remains an important piece within her body of work, offering insight into the artist's thematic interests and the broader cultural context of 19th-century France.
